Rhododendron ‘Polarnacht’
Rhododendron - Polar Night
An elepidote, medium growing Rhododendron. 2 1/3″ to 3″ flowers are near black in bud and open dark purple with an even darker blotch. Blooms late midseason in trusses of 12-14 flowers. Compact, grows 3′ high by 6′ wide in a 10 year period.

Origin
Hybrid seedling of Rhododendron 'Turkana' and Rhododendron 'Purple Splendour'. Introduced by Hans Hachmann of Germany in 1976.
Special Notes
Exposure: Morning Sun, afternoon shade or all day filtered light. Protect from the hot mid-day sun. Protect from the prevailing winter winds, plant in a sheltered location.
Soil: A very acidic, moist but well draining soil is required. Avoid heavy compacted soils such as clay.
Maintenance: Selective pruning right after flowering in done. Dead-heading is recommended for increased flower production the following year.
